The third day of arriving in Fukui Prefecture.

Akemi finally appeared, driving Lin Yi and the others towards the mountains.

In the car, Akemi threw two small notebooks to Lin Yi and Wakasugi Toshihide.

Lin Yi picked one up and saw that it was a gun permit.

The photo was his own, but the name was not his real name.

Akemi saw Lin Yi's confusion and explained, "You can only apply for a gun permit when you're twenty years old. You're not old enough, so I got you an extra identity."

Lin Yi suddenly understood. He looked at the other small notebook, which was a hunting license.

Lin Yi said, "So… we're going hunting? And the guns we're using are hunting rifles?"

Akemi smiled and nodded, saying, "That's right… First, get familiar with the hunting rifles, and after we get deep into the mountains, we'll switch to other guns."

Lin Yi understood Akemi's meaning, which was to use hunting as a pretense, and then switch to the guns they would use for the robbery after they entered the deep mountains.

This surprised Lin Yi quite a bit. He didn't expect Akemi to have made so many preparations for this robbery beforehand. The anime didn't show it in detail.

Oh… that's right, each episode of the anime is at most thirty minutes long. After cutting out the opening and ending credits, and some commercials in between, the content is only about twenty-five minutes long. After cutting out some unnecessary dialogue, the core content is less than fifteen minutes before and after.

Naturally, there is a lot of content that is not shown.

Akemi didn't have any objections to the addition of Kōsaka Kana, after all, everyone here knew each other.

After driving for an hour, the car was on a dirt road. The road was very bumpy, and they had to slow down.

After driving on the bumpy road for another two hours, they finally arrived at a forest cabin.

"Are we there?" Wakasugi Toshihide's butt was sore from sitting. As soon as he saw the car stop, he quickly asked.

"Yes, we're here."

Akemi pulled the handbrake, turned off the engine, and got out of the car.

The four of them carried their backpacks, crossed a wooden bridge, and walked towards the forest cabin.

Akemi led the way, saying as she walked, "We'll be staying there for the next three days… I'll help you learn how to shoot as soon as possible."

Wakasugi Toshihide asked curiously, "Where are the guns?"

"Hidden near the house."

"Hidden?" Wakasugi Toshihide looked around curiously and said, "This place is in the wilderness and there are no surveillance cameras… What if someone finds them and takes them away?"

"The guns and bullets are hidden separately… If an intruder finds them all, we can only say that we're unlucky. Hmm? Big guy, what's wrong with your legs?" Suddenly, Akemi noticed Wakasugi Toshihide's uncoordinated walking posture.

"N-nothing." Wakasugi Toshihide tried to hide it.

But Lin Yi said, "We've been in Fukui Prefecture for two days, and he's been fucking women in the room for two days. It's like he's never touched a woman in his life… You don't know how strange the female staff looked at him when we checked out."

Wakasugi Toshihide's face turned red, and he shouted, "It wasn't two days… it wasn't even 48 hours!"

"Then how long was it?"

"Just… just about 38 hours."

"Then you're really amazing, working 19 hours a day, with only 5 hours for eating, drinking, shitting, and sleeping. I admire you, I admire you."

"It's alright… hahaha."

Watching him still being able to laugh shamelessly, Lin Yi was very touched.

He witnessed how a virgin became a whoremonger.

After opening the forest cabin with the key, Akemi checked that the water, electricity, and gas were all fine, and then picked up a shovel and called everyone to a certain spot in the open space behind the house to start digging.

Soon, she dug out a box. She changed another place and dug again, and dug out another small box.

After moving the boxes into the house.

Upon opening them, they were exactly what they needed.

One box of guns, one box of bullets.

Akemi began to distribute the guns, one hunting rifle, rifle, and pistol per person. Kōsaka Kana didn't get any.

"We're two days late, so we only have three days. Time is tight, so I'll tell you about the precautions for using the guns on the way."

"So urgent?" Wakasugi Toshihide felt that his legs were a little stiff: "Can't we rest a little longer?"

Akemi smiled wryly and said, "Today is already the first day… Although we have a whole day tomorrow, we have to leave by noon the day after tomorrow. I still have to rush back to work."

"Alright…" Wakasugi Toshihide touched the cold gun and could only accept his fate.

The three of them set off with their guns and ammunition on their backs. Kōsaka Kana was in charge of logistics, preparing some instant food for lunch.

After walking from the forest cabin to the back of the mountain, there were small paths along the way, so it wasn't very tiring. Carrying three guns and bullets on their bodies was still a bit heavy, but the three of them were in relatively good physical condition, so they could bear it.

Along the way, Akemi began to explain the precautions for using the guns.

Needless to say about the hunting rifle, it was for disguise. Although this place was in the wilderness and there were no passers-by, if any villagers happened to pass by, the hunting rifle could come in handy.

Rifles and pistols are the focus of learning.

No one knows what unexpected situations might arise during a robbery.

If there is no resistance throughout the process and the money is successfully stolen, that would be the best outcome.

But if resistance is encountered, then it will be necessary to shoot.

Learning to use rifles and pistols now is for that very consideration.

The armored truck personnel will not show you any mercy.

After walking for an hour, they arrived at a clearing where trees had been cut down.

"Alright, this is the place."

Akemi dropped the guns and ammunition on the ground. She picked up a piece of rotten wood from the ground and, after walking a short distance forward, placed it on a tree stump.

She came back, picked up a pistol first, and while loading it, said to the two of them: "After loading the bullets, pull back to chamber a round, then turn off the safety."

"Eyes, muzzle, target... in a straight line, then extend both arms, grip the pistol tightly... pull the trigger!"

With a "bang" sound.

The rotten wood on the tree stump was immediately blasted away.

"After shooting, turn on the safety."

Akemi pointed the muzzle at the ground and said seriously: "The most important thing is that, regardless of whether the safety is on or off, never aim the muzzle at yourself or your teammates."

At this moment, by chance, Wakamatsu Toshihide brought his eyes close to the muzzle of the pistol, seemingly wanting to see clearly what the internal structure was.

Seeing this, Akemi reminded him: "Even if it's a gun without a magazine! Because these guns were sent by others, no one can guarantee that they have carefully checked each gun's chamber for bullets. If there is one, and it accidentally goes off..."

Hearing this, Wakamatsu Toshihide laughed: "The probability of that is too low... It usually doesn't happen. I don't believe it, watch."

As he said that, Wakamatsu Toshihide pointed the pistol without a magazine at the ground, then turned off the safety and pulled the trigger.

With a "bang" sound, a flash of fire burst from the muzzle of the pistol, and Wakamatsu Toshihide's face turned pale.
